What I Looked for in the Light Quality
One of the first things I checked was the brightness and color options of the light. I found that a good phone stand with light should offer adjustable brightness so I can use it in different settings. I also preferred models with warm, neutral, and cool light modes because they gave me more control over how I looked on camera.
Why Stability Mattered to Me
I learned that a stand is only useful if it stays steady. I paid close attention to the base design, grip strength, and overall build quality. A heavy base or a strong clamp made me feel more confident that my phone would stay secure, especially when I adjusted the angle or height.
Adjustability Was a Big Factor
I found adjustable height and angle to be very important. A stand that can tilt, rotate, or extend gave me much more flexibility. This made it easier for me to position my phone at eye level, which was especially helpful during long video calls and recording sessions.
My Thoughts on Portability
Since I sometimes move between my desk, bedroom, and travel bag, portability was another thing I considered. I liked stands that were lightweight and easy to fold. If I wanted something for home use only, I was more willing to choose a sturdier and slightly bulkier model.
Charging and Power Options I Considered
I also checked how the light was powered. Some models use USB power, while others are rechargeable. I personally preferred a rechargeable option when I wanted fewer wires, but USB-powered stands worked well for my desk setup because I could keep them plugged in.
Extra Features That Helped Me Decide
Some phone stands came with useful extras like a remote shutter, Bluetooth compatibility, or a ring light design. I found these features helpful depending on how I planned to use the stand. For example, a remote made it easier for me to take photos or start videos without touching the phone.
How I Balanced Price and Quality
I didn’t want to overspend, but I also didn’t want a cheap stand that would break quickly. I looked for the best balance between price and durability. In my experience, spending a little more often gave me better lighting, stronger materials, and smoother adjustment.
